Related Post: 23 Most Valuable State Quarters Worth Money. Features of the 1970 Quarter The Obverse of the 1970 Quarter. Image: coins. The obverse, or “heads” side, of the 1970 quarter bears the image of George Washington, the USA’s first president. The design had first been used in 1932, the bicentenary of Washington’s birth.

They’d probably be in display cases with protective covers. Here’s how much 1982-D quarters are worth: Well-worn 1982-D quarters are worth their face value of 25 cents. Lightly circulated 1982-D quarters can take 30 to 50 cents apiece. Uncirculated 1982-D quarters are usually worth $2.50 to $3.50 each. In fact, the Susan B. Anthony dollar, which was made from 1979 through 1981 and once more in 1999, is the only silver-colored United States dollar coin that wasn’t made in silver — not even as a proof coin for collectors.. These quarters, issued by the United States Mint as part of the 50 State Quarters program, feature unique designs representing each state in the ...In uncirculated condition, though, the value is higher. A 1983 quarter graded MS63 (the “MS” stands for “mint state”) is valued at $14 by the independent coin graders, the PCGS. At MS65, that value increases to $46, and $600 at MS67. However, people easily confused the new dollar coin with a quarter and therefore it was rejected by the public. Demand dropped and production ceased in 1981. Due to a request from the United States Postal Service, the mint produced another run of these dollar coins in 1999. ... The Top 15 Most Valuable Quarters. Susan B. In general, a 1965 quarter is not considered rare. It’s one of the most common coins from the 1960s. However, some specific factors can make a 1965 quarter more valuable or sought-after by collectors. For example: Mint Mark: Most 1965 quarters were struck at the Philadelphia Mint, which did not use a mint mark ...
